Johnny Manziel is everywhere these days. Just last week Manziel was hanging out with LeBron James and on Sunday night the Texas A&M quarterback was in Arlington to throw out the first pitch before the Texas Rangers played the Los Angeles Angels.

And while you don't get a great perspective of the pitch in this video, let's just say Johnny should stick to throwing footballs because had there been a right-handed batter standing at the plate he'd have caught a Johnny Fastball to the dome.

Manziel blamed the lack of control on his nerves.

"Every person kept saying, 'Don't bounce it, don't bounce it,'" he told USA Today. "I was wild, a little nervous."
